Tania Carmenate is a scholar working on Immunology, Radiology, Nuclear Medicine and Imaging and Microbiology. According to data from OpenAlex, Tania Carmenate has authored 26 papers receiving a total of 398 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Immunology, 11 papers in Radiology, Nuclear Medicine and Imaging and 11 papers in Microbiology. Recurrent topics in Tania Carmenate's work include Bacterial Infections and Vaccines (11 papers), Monoclonal and Polyclonal Antibodies Research (11 papers) and T-cell and B-cell Immunology (9 papers). Tania Carmenate is often cited by papers focused on Bacterial Infections and Vaccines (11 papers), Monoclonal and Polyclonal Antibodies Research (11 papers) and T-cell and B-cell Immunology (9 papers). Tania Carmenate collaborates with scholars based in Cuba, Portugal and Germany. Tania Carmenate's co-authors include Kalet León, Ernesto Moreno, Michel Enamorado, Gertrudis Rojas, Alexis Musacchio, Amaury Pupo, Luís Graça, Sachdev S. Sidhu, Glay Chinea and Violeta Fernández-Santana and has published in prestigious journals such as The Journal of Immunology, Scientific Reports and Infection and Immunity.
